Mikromilia (Oshtitsa)
Mikromilia (Oshtitsa) is a village in Kato Nevrokopi, Drama, East Macedonia and Thrace and has about 36 residents. Mikromilia (Oshtitsa) is situated nearby to the village Potamoi, as well as near the hamlet Kallikarpo (Lovchishta).| Tap on a place to explore it |

Potamoi, until 1927 known as Borovo, is a village in the Drama regional unit, Greece. It is situated in the Chech region, at the mouth of the river Dospat on the left shore of the river Nestos. Potamoi is situated 5 km southwest of Mikromilia (Oshtitsa).

Sidironero is a village and a former community in the Drama regional unit, East Macedonia and Thrace, Greece. It has traditionally had a Bulgarian Muslim, or Pomak citizenry, like the rest of the Chech geographic region. Sidironero is situated 8 km southeast of Mikromilia (Oshtitsa).
